Wooden Veranda Construction Questions
What materials are used for wooden verandas? Typically, hardwoods or softwoods like c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ine are selected for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can a wooden veranda be customized to match existing property styles? Yes, designs can be tailored to complement the architecture and personal preferences of the property.
What maintenance is required for a wooden veranda? Regular sealing, staining, and inspections help preserve the wood and prevent damage over time.
Are wooden verandas suitable for different property types? Wooden verandas can enhance various residential styles, including traditional, modern, and cottage homes.
